What is Mindfulness Meditation?
Mindfulness meditation is a practice that involves bringing your attention to the present moment. This can be done through focusing on your breath, sensations in your body, or the thoughts that come up in your mind. The goal of mindfulness meditation is to be aware of the present moment without judgement or attachment. It can help you become more aware of your feelings and thoughts, allowing you to be better equipped to manage them.
Mindfulness meditation is a form of meditation that has been practiced for thousands of years. It has been scientifically proven to help reduce stress, anxiety, improve mood, and enhance concentration. It can also help promote a sense of calmness and inner peace.
How Does Mindfulness Meditation Help Reduce Stress?
Mindfulness meditation can help reduce stress by teaching you to observe your thoughts and feelings without judgement or attachment. By focusing on your breath and allowing your thoughts to come and go without attaching to them, you can learn to stay in the present moment. This can help you become more aware of your thoughts and feelings, allowing you to better manage them. Mindfulness meditation can also help you become more aware of the physical sensations in your body associated with stress, such as tightness in the chest or a racing heart, and learn to relax them.
Mindfulness meditation can also help create a sense of inner peace and calmness. By focusing on the present moment and allowing thoughts and feelings to come and go without judgement, you can create a sense of space and acceptance. This can help you to become more aware of your thoughts and feelings, which can lead to a greater sense of inner peace and calmness.
Tips for Practicing Mindfulness Meditation
Mindfulness meditation can be practiced anywhere and at any time. Here are some tips to help you get started:
- Find a comfortable position. Sitting or lying down, whichever is more comfortable for you.
- Focus on your breath. Take slow, deep breaths and pay attention to the sensation of your breath.
- Let your thoughts come and go. Notice your thoughts but don’t attach to them. Let them pass without judgement.
- Stay focused on the present moment. Notice the physical sensations in your body and the sounds around you.
